深基坑气动井点降水关键技术研究

扫码查看
深基坑开挖时,由于要深入地下一段距离,因此当基坑范围很大时,会接触到不同类型的地下水。传统的排水方法很难将大量的地下水排出,从而影响基坑的稳定性、围护结构的安全,严重时还会威胁到周边建筑的安全。文章从基坑开挖时的降水措施着手,重点论述气动在基坑中的技术运用和施工方法。通过以上措施,能够有效解决基坑开挖过程中出现的排水问题,从而保证了施工的质量与安全。
